Core eSignature and workflow capabilities to evaluate

Key features affect deployment speed, security, and daily operations. Below are six functional areas to compare when reviewing signNow CRM vs Zendesk Sell for organizations.

eSignature

Electronic signing with validated intent, customizable signature fields, and support for common signature flows ensures legally enforceable agreements under ESIGN and UETA when used with adequate identity measures.

Bulk Send

Send a single document to many recipients with individualized signing links and batch monitoring to streamline mass distributions such as offers, NDAs, and enrollment forms.

Templates

Create reusable document templates with fixed fields, conditional logic, and role-based placeholders to reduce preparation time and ensure consistent data capture across recurring agreements.

API

RESTful APIs for embedding signing, creating envelopes, and retrieving audit trails enable automation within CRM records, back-office systems, and custom portals for programmatic document lifecycles.

Audit Trail

Comprehensive tamper-evident logs record timestamps, IP addresses, and action history for every document to support dispute resolution and compliance audits.

Mobile Signing

Mobile-optimized signing experiences and native apps support on-the-go approvals and offline workflows, maintaining signature validity while improving completion rates.

Integrations and templates: practical differences to consider

Integration depth and template handling drive how well signing fits into existing sales and service operations. Examine these four integration and template capabilities when comparing signNow CRM vs Zendesk Sell for organizations.

Google Docs Integration

Two-way integration allows documents created in Google Docs to be converted into templates, prefilled with CRM data, and sent for signature while retaining version history and collaborative editing controls.

CRM Connectors

Native and third-party connectors map CRM fields to document templates, automate envelope generation from opportunities or contacts, and capture signed documents back into the CRM record for compliance and auditability.

Dropbox and Cloud Storage

Direct links to Dropbox, Google Drive, and other cloud stores simplify document import/export, maintain folder hierarchies, and enable automated archiving of signed agreements to controlled storage.

Reusable Document Templates

Robust template libraries with merge fields, conditional sections, and role definitions reduce manual assembly, improve accuracy, and allow organizations to scale contract generation across teams.

Best practices for secure and reliable signing workflows

Adopt consistent processes that preserve legal validity, protect data, and reduce rework across sales and service teams.

Use standardized templates and merge fields
Create and maintain a library of approved templates with clearly mapped merge fields tied to CRM records. Standardization reduces errors, ensures consistent legal language, and speeds document generation for repeatable workflows across teams.
Select appropriate signer authentication
Choose authentication methods that match transaction risk and regulatory needs, such as email verification for low-risk agreements and SMS or third-party ID verification for higher-risk or regulated transactions to strengthen evidence of signer identity.
Maintain thorough audit trails and storage
Ensure every signature event is logged with timestamps, IPs, and actions and store signed documents in secure, access-controlled storage with versioning to support audits and potential disputes.
Train users and enforce access controls
Provide role-based training for template creation, sending, and record management. Enforce least-privilege access to reduce accidental data exposure and maintain separation of duties for approvals and document management.
